CONCLUSION
Dragon Pharma BPC 157 5mg is an experimental peptide product containing BPC 157, a synthetic pentadecapeptide investigated in laboratory studies for its possible involvement in repair-related biological pathways, vascular signaling, gastrointestinal models and connective tissue research.
Unlike approved pharmaceutical therapies, BPC 157 does not currently have established clinical dosing guidelines, approved therapeutic indications, or comprehensive long-term human safety data. Current knowledge is primarily derived from preclinical investigations and laboratory research.
For athletes and bodybuilding communities, BPC 157 has gained attention because of interest in recovery mechanisms and tissue-related research. However, responsible interpretation requires understanding that experimental peptides should not be considered replacements for approved medical treatments or evidence-based injury management strategies.
